How Does Vedanta Resources Ltd. Reach Its Customers?
Vedanta Resources Ltd. deploys a multi-faceted sales strategy dominated by long-term B2B contracts, which account for over 85% of its $18.5 billion FY25 revenue. This core approach is supplemented by a dedicated digital portal and new partnerships aimed at expanding market reach, particularly within the MSME sector.
A team of over 1,200 sales professionals manages key accounts, securing long-term offtake agreements with major industrial consumers. Contracts are primarily negotiated with prices benchmarked to the London Metal Exchange, ensuring competitive alignment with global markets.
The digital procurement platform handles approximately 12% of the company's sales, focusing on the spot market for smaller orders. This channel significantly enhances operational efficiency and provides accessibility for a broader client base.
Initiated in 2024, a partnership with over 30 MSME-focused e-commerce platforms represents a strategic shift to distribute processed metal products. This initiative targets a 15% increase in market share within the small industrial consumer segment by 2026.
Exclusive agreements, such as the 2023 partnership with Foxconn for high-purity copper, are critical for downstream integration. These deals secure Vedanta's position in emerging supply chains, capturing additional value from specialized high-demand products.
The overarching Vedanta Resources sales strategy is designed to secure stable revenue through contracted volumes while pursuing agile growth via digital and new market channels. What Marketing Tactics Does Vedanta Resources Ltd. Use?
Vedanta Resources Ltd. has radically evolved its marketing mix into a sophisticated, data-driven strategy centered on digital communication and high-value content. This approach prioritizes stakeholder trust and transparency, moving far beyond traditional B2B outreach to engage investors, regulators, and communities effectively.
The cornerstone of the Vedanta marketing strategy is its 'Resources for India's Growth' platform. It publishes extensive ESG reports and sustainability roadmaps, which drove a 35% increase in positive media mentions in FY24.
Campaigns on LinkedIn and financial portals emphasize its $6.8 billion tax contribution and net-zero by 2050 goal. This targeted advertising is a key part of the Vedanta Resources sales strategy for attracting institutional investment.
Chairman Anil Agarwal's social media presence generates over 5 million monthly impressions. His commentary on national resource security is a powerful tool for Vedanta brand positioning.
A key innovation is an AI tool that segments audiences from ESG funds to local communities. This enables hyper-personalized communication critical to the Vedanta stakeholder engagement strategy.
These targeted marketing tactics directly supported securing $3.2 billion in green financing in 2024. This demonstrates the tangible ROI of its corporate communication strategy.

How Is Vedanta Resources Ltd. Positioned in the Market?
Vedanta Resources Ltd. firmly anchors its brand positioning in the nationalistic narrative of being the 'Builder of Bharat'. This strategy differentiates it from global mining giants by intertwining its corporate success with India's industrial progress, a theme central to its Vedanta Resources marketing strategy. The company’s identity, communicated through assertive and patriotic tones and the use of saffron and green, promises resource sovereignty and a reliable domestic supply chain, earning it the #2 rank in the 2024 Brand Trust Report for India's industrial sector.
The company’s Vedanta brand marketing campaigns consistently leverage the saffron and green of the Indian flag. This visual language is a constant reminder of its commitment to national development and serves as a key differentiator in its corporate communication strategy.
Vedanta’s focus on national strategic value has yielded measurable results, securing its position as the second most trusted brand in India's industrial sector according to the 2024 Brand Trust Report. This achievement validates its effective Vedanta corporate communication strategy.
A core part of its messaging highlights the creation of over 75,000 direct jobs, directly linking its operations to economic growth and societal benefit. This is a cornerstone of its Vedanta stakeholder engagement strategy and overall sales and marketing plan.
Proactively addressing past critiques, the brand now communicates a $900 million annual investment in sustainable mining technology. This commitment to zero-discharge operations is integral to its modern Vedanta brand positioning and marketing mix.
The Vedanta Resources marketing strategy is built on three core messages that resonate with its B2B customer acquisition strategy and support its overarching business model. These pillars ensure a consistent and compelling brand story across all channels.
- Resource Sovereignty: Emphasizing domestic control over natural resources as a national imperative.
- Domestic Value Addition: Highlighting the processing of raw materials within India to boost the local economy.
- Sustainable Extraction: Showcasing technological investments and environmental stewardship as a key competitive advantage.

What Are Vedanta Resources Ltd.’s Most Notable Campaigns?
Vedanta Resources deploys high-impact campaigns to drive its Vedanta Resources sales strategy and market positioning. Recent key campaigns, such as 'Semiconductor for India' and 'Women at Vedanta,' have successfully targeted specific stakeholders and delivered measurable business outcomes, from stock appreciation to talent acquisition.
Launched in Q4 2023, this initiative aimed to establish the company as a foundational player in India's tech ecosystem. The 'From Silicon to Systems' creative concept articulated its vertical integration strategy from mining quartz to manufacturing chips.
The 2021 campaign showcased female leaders in mining to reshape industry perceptions and attract new talent. It resulted in a 40% increase in female engineering applications and won a Gold STEVIE Award for communications.
The Semiconductor campaign was deployed across LinkedIn, financial dailies, and government stakeholder events. This multi-channel approach is central to the corporate growth strategy and generated over 200 million impressions.
Analysts directly credited the Semiconductor campaign for a 12% rise in its stock price following key regulatory approvals. This demonstrates the powerful link between its corporate communication strategy and financial performance.
